Sophie trained as a biochemist in Kenya then specialized in Immunology and later obtained a PhD in malaria epidemiology from the University of Heidelberg. She has great interest in understanding how human genetics influences susceptibility to severe malaria. Her current research aims to investigate the mechanisms behind the development and treatment of severe anemia with focus on the quality of blood used for transfusion. Her work also describes the burden of sickle cell disease in Africa.
